AI Revolution: How a Nonprofit Worker Created a Heartwarming Film (2026)

The world of cinema is abuzz with the story of Robert Gaudette, a 54-year-old nonprofit worker who has seemingly revolutionized the film industry with his AI-generated masterpiece, 'A Face Only a Mother Could Love.' This short film, with its tender narrative and visually stunning scenes, has sparked a debate about the future of filmmaking and the role of AI in creative endeavors.

The Rise of AI Filmmaking

Gaudette's journey is a testament to the power of AI and its potential to democratize the film industry. With no formal film training and a background in tech and photography, he taught himself the necessary skills to bring his vision to life. His story challenges the traditional notion of filmmaking, where resources and connections often determine success.
